ZANET is an advanced suspension concentrate (SC) formulation that combines the systemic fungicide Thiophanate-methyl with the antibiotic bactericide Kasugamycin. This unique dual-action product delivers preventive and curative control against a broad range of fungal and bacterial diseases in several crops. Zanet is absorbed by the roots and leaves of the treated plant, forming a protective barrier while moving upward through the plant's xylem for thorough systemic protection.

Mode of Action
Zanet combines two active ingredients for dual-action disease control: it inhibits the development of amino acids in the ribosome system of fungi & bacteria, preventing protein synthesis in both. Absorbed through roots and leaves, it moves systemically upward through the plant's xylem, forming a protective barrier while also delivering curative action against established infections.
Crop
Disease
Dose (ml/acre)
Dilution in Water (Liter/acre)
Tomato
Powdery mildew & Bacterial leaf spot
400–500
150–200
Potato (Tuber Seed Treatment)
Black Scurf
3.5 ml / 10 Kg of Tuber Seed
200 ml water per 10 Kg of Tuber Seed
